The LOWENERGIE Toilet Water Saving Device is a dual-pack cistern tank insert designed to save water by reducing the flush volume in older toilet cisterns. Each bag holds up to 2 litres of water and features an air lock fill valve to prevent evaporation. Made from durable, non-corrosive materials, this maintenance-free solution is easy to install and ideal for eco-conscious households.

After my water bill crept up again this quarter, I have no choice than to take drastic measures to reduce water usage somehow, using the water providers usage tool it suggested I try reducing the water used when flushing the toilets. So got one of these water savers 2Lts, it was easy to filll and fit into place. However quickly realised a bottle of water in the same place does the same job. So unfortunately I wouldn’t have brought the water saver bag if I had known I could recycle a water bottle and use that instead for free.
